a 62kg wake boarder is being pulled by a boat with a force of 124 newton’s was is the acceleration of the wake boarder

Chemistry
1 answer:
givi [52]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

<h2>2 m/s²</h2>

Explanation:

The acceleration of an object given it's mass and the force acting on it can be found by using the formula

a =  \frac{f}{m }  \\

f is the force

m is the mass

From the question we have

a =  \frac{124}{62}  \\

We have the final answer as

<h3>2 m/s²</h3>

What is an example of a Low Energy-created depositional environment?
sweet-ann [11.9K]

Answer:

River flood plains, swamps, lakes, lagoons, marshes, and offshore.

Explanation:

Slow-moving currents prevent coarse-grained sediment from migrating into low-energy depositional environments. Fine materials can be carried long distances before they can settle out in the absence of waves and currents.

How many energy levels does calcium have?
Usimov [2.4K]
The element calcium has a total of four energy levels<span> that each can hold a certain number of electrons. Its first and fourth energy levels hold two electrons each, and its second and third energy levels hold eight electrons each.</span>
